About this program

The Diploma in Information Technology at Multimedia University is designed to provide students with a solid foundation in essential IT skills and knowledge. The course covers various key areas, including programming, database management, networking, and web development. Students will engage in hands-on projects, allowing them to apply what they learn in real-world scenarios, enhancing their problem-solving and technical skills.

This program typically consists of a mix of theoretical lectures and practical laboratory sessions, giving students the opportunity to work with the latest technologies and tools in the IT industry. Throughout the course, students will develop critical skills such as analytical thinking, effective communication, and teamwork, all of which are vital for a successful career in technology.

Entry requirements

Applicants for the Diploma in Information Technology should typically have completed their secondary education with commendable results. Ideally, candidates should possess a background in science or mathematics to support their studies in IT-related subjects.

English:

Students are generally expected to have a good command of the English language. This can be demonstrated through qualifications such as IELTS or TOEFL, with required scores often varying but typically around a 6.0-6.5 IELTS or 80-90 TOEFL.

International students:

International students need to check the official visa requirements for studying in the country. Typically, this includes having a valid passport, proof of acceptance into the program, financial evidence, and health insurance, among other potential documents.
